    Chapter One:  The Alley Incident

    Uncle Beazly was a tomcat. A very wild, very unfriendly and somewhat mangy animal that frequented the alleys around the neighborhood.  Evan, and the bully down the Street, Gary, used to do their best to torment that animal, hoping to drive it away. Because despite all their problems, they both hated that animal worst of all.

    The particular day it happened was a Tuesday. Definitely.

    Spelling had been a cinch that day, and that was how Evan remembered what day it was. Three thirty had come quicker that day, probably because the semester  was almost over, and the summer was going to be AWESOME. He was new to the school, and making friends had always been easy for Evan. Probably partly because he was so outgoing, but also because he was so used to the role. Being the ‘new kid’ meant he got to tell his story again. He had two sisters, both younger, and a mom and a dad. Dad was a salesman, right now selling Vacuum Cleaners. Mom was studying to get her insurance license again – she’d had one before, back in Kansas, but the laws and rules about insurance were different here in Arizona. Yeah, they had algebra in Kansas.
